Solution Lead
At Master of Code Global we are a team of experts developing custom world-class digital experiences for web, mobile, as well as conversational chat and voice solutions empowered by AI.
Founded in 2004, with more than 250+ Masters globally, and 400+ projects delivered, our solutions have been used by more than 1 billion users worldwide. Our diverse portfolio includes global brands, enterprises, as well as successful startups, such as Golden State Warriors, T-Mobile, LivePerson, World Surf League, MTV, Aveda, Jo Malone, Infobip, eBags, Burberry, Estee Lauder, Post, Glia, and others.
We are a service company with a product mindset and experience proven by the success of our own products, a suite of apps for the Shopify e-commerce platform that is used by 10,000+ stores globally. We believe in long-term partnerships with our clients, guiding them towards their vision and success, while keeping a strong focus on exceptional end-user experiences. We provide enterprise-grade delivery, including being ISO27001 certified, and at the same time the agility to match the pace of startups. And we infuse that with our company DNA built on Passion, Trust, Impact, Growth, Respect, and Fun.
At Master of Code Global, we aspire to go far beyond impacting over a billion people worldwide with unparalleled digital experiences. We are helping to seamlessly integrate AI into businesses, elevating their performance and customer satisfaction.
-
Purpose of the role
- We’re looking for a Solution Lead for our Conversational projects.
-
Required background and skills
- Deep experience with key technologies relevant to the company’s solutions including:
- Any combination of JavaScript/TypeScript (both front-end and back-end), or Python, Java;
- Cloud platforms – any of AWS, GCP, Azure;
- DevOps and CI/CD as an approach on the level of understanding and management;
- Service-based architecture and serverless approach;
- Understanding of ML principles and basic experience with ML frameworks and language model tuning;
- Understanding of the common database-related issues and optimization challenges
- Proven consulting expertise as a key technical resource leading the development and delivery of solutions
- Significant experience working as part of a team environment. Each project will require that you work as part of a close-knit team of professionals to achieve the desired results
- Experience managing and advocating for customer issues or needs
- Excellent verbal and written communication skills for both business and technical presentations
- Ability to learn new technologies and switch on the fly on the level of challenges understanding and management
- Upper-Intermediate English
-
Responsibilities
- Solution Design & Architecture – Collaborate with stakeholders to gather requirements and identify project needs. Architect and design technical solutions tailored to meet the project’s requirements. Ensure that the designed solution integrates seamlessly with existing systems and platforms.
- Technical Consulting – Serve as the primary technical point of contact for clients, project managers, and other non-technical stakeholders. Communicate complex technical details in a manner that is easily understood by non-technical stakeholders. Conduct the solution demos, gather feedback, and make necessary adjustments to the solution as required.
- Technical Solution Management – Manage the SDLC process of the project (from pre-sales through implementation and go-live/post-UAT) Actively participate in the coding and implementation process, as needed. Review code and provide feedback to developers to ensure quality and adherence to best practices. Validate and test solutions to ensure they meet business needs and technical requirements.
- Customer Satisfaction – Maintain a high level of customer response and satisfaction based on both survey and attrition indicators. Prioritize customer needs and experience in designing and implementing solutions, acting as the client advocate in internal discussions and planning.
- Strategic Initiatives – Being an advocate of the company’s innovations and initiatives. Collaborate with the technical communities to stay updated and promote industry trends, new technologies, and best practices. Identify opportunities for process improvements and innovative solutions. Participate in post-project reviews to capture learnings and areas for improvement. Implement and document the technical best practices and approaches within the team and company.
- Delivering Best practices – Being responsible for the project SDLC technical documentation. Document solutions, architecture decisions, and other relevant details for future reference. Ensure that knowledge is shared across the team and organization, promoting consistency and efficiency.
- Be the point of contact and serve to support all technical-related activities. These include:
- Educating the customer on “how to’s” and technical requirements/capabilities
- Support kickoff on deployment process and methodology
- Serve as the first point of contact for technical information around security, performance, and deployment practices for customers
- Supports customer testing
- Supports Presales team to build demo environments for prospective client opportunities
- Conducts scoping and provides estimates around technical requirements and solutions
- Demonstration of the product capabilities and extensions to existing clients
- Proof of concepts and feasibility assessments for integrations
-
Preferred/Nice to have skills
- Some exposure to iOS and Android development frameworks & concepts is beneficial
- Any additional technologies mentioned above on the level of understanding of the ecosystem
-
Location:
- Kyiv / Ukraine Remote
Have got some time left?)
You could devote it to your favorite activity or read about us on our social networks.